Well we have our regular hass avocado from Mexico but have you heard of Dominican avocado.
Dominican avocado is also known as “Desbry Tropical Avocados”.
They have a thinner layer of skin and a little fun fact is that they oxidize slower than our Hass avocado.
Besides having a thinner layer of avocado skin, the biggest difference is the size and the taste.
The Dominican avocado has a smoother texture and is great for on any type of bread.
It brings out a hint of sweet and creamy taste and would be a great substitute on a salad.
For anyone who is trying this for the first time, I would suggest shaking the avocado to test the ripeness.
Unlike our hass avocado we do not press on the Dominican avocado, we shake it.
If the avocado makes a beat when you shake it, it is most likely a ripe avocado.
Cut the avocado up into cubes, drizzle it with some olive oil and you can make a delicious guacamole, avocado toast, or even avocado dessert.
